Art History is the study of art and its development over time. It involves the study of a variety of media, such as painting, sculpture, architecture, photography, film, performance art and digital art. Art history also encompasses the study of how different cultures have approached art in different times and places.
In order to understand how art has developed over time it is important to understand the historical and cultural context in which it has been produced. Art historians use a range of methods to research and analyze works of art.
These include formal analysis, iconography (the interpretation of symbols), and stylistic analysis (looking at elements such as shape, line, color). Art historians also look at other aspects such as patronage, meaning and reception.
The aim of art history is to provide an understanding of how art has been shaped by its context and how it reflects our own culture. It is not only concerned with aesthetic value but also with understanding the social, political and religious contexts in which works have been created. Art history can also help us to think critically about our own culture by looking at works from other cultures or times.
